Output 640eb5703c421edec818c9a51052db67f5f46761a36c522dd4551c7073762c80:177

value
64834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31dc84fc668cadb0b1b77b3da854718ce6246c67 OP_EQUAL
address
36EfCuTb1pHuxvji9jNE4eSCa8WGdgqnCT
transaction
640eb5703c421edec818c9a51052db67f5f46761a36c522dd4551c7073762c80
spent
true